Upper Gwinn is a flexible event space with two primary rooms that can be combined or split depending on the needs of each event: Queen Anne room (QA) and Cascade room (CA). The space includes a foyer and a meeting room called the President's Dining Room (PDR). Each of the rooms in Upper Gwinn contains a configurable AV system that can match the combined or split modes of the physical space. The system was completely overhauled in December 2016 and January 2017 and now features modern audio and video capabilities while retaining the original system's functionality with the exception of AV connectivity to the President's Dining Room (PDR).   • When the system is off, the default page is presented on the touch panel. To turn the system on, tap on either start button depending on the physical configuration of the room. The next section of this article covers the differences between combined mode and split mode.
  • When the start button is pressed, the projector(s) will automatically turn on and the screen(s) will automatically lower. By default, the PC input is selected for video and input audio. Wireless microphone #1 is automatically un-muted in the AV system.

Options available for quick-access on the screen include (clockwise from bottom) the menu bar, available inputs, input volume (for the currently selected input), master volume (a combination of all inputs and microphones), projector screen up/down controls, and the projector mute toggle button.
  • At this point, the system is turned on and basic events can commence with the PC input selected and 1 wireless microphone enabled.
